- Nursing and Allied Health RFA FY 2025-2027
-
Request for Applications (RFA) for the 2025-2027 Nursing, Allied Health, and Other Health-Related Education Grant Program (NAHP) are now available online. NAHP was established to provide grant funding to eligible institutions that propose to address the shortage of registered nurses (RN) in Texas by developing or expanding projects that promote innovation in the preparation of initial RN licensure nursing students and of faculty who may teach in initial RN licensure programs.

- Rural Resident Physician Grant Program Request for Applications FY25
-
This Request for Applications (RFA) is to support eligible Applicants that intend to apply for funding to develop or enhance residency programs in rural areas. The RRPP seeks to establish new or expand existing graduate medical education programs in rural and non-metropolitan areas of Texas to help meet the healthcare needs of rural communities across the state.
